Southwestern Insurance Information Service (SIIS) has named Monica Vigil-McDonald as its new communications coordinator.
Vigil-McDonald will report directly to SIIS President Sandra Helin and the SIIS board of directors to create and implement the organization’s overall communications strategy.
Vigil-McDonald joins SIIS from KVUE News in Austin, Texas, where she produces the midday newscast. Prior to KVUE, she worked as a public relations consultant for the Catholic Diocese of Austin and as the communications director of the Texas House of Representatives.
Founded in 1953, SIIS represents insurers writing in excess of 85 percent of the property and casualty premiums in Texas and Oklahoma.
